"CRUISING - There is no better way to see Seattle than from the water. One of the possibilities is to take the cruise that connects Puget Sound with Lake Union via the Hiram Chittenden Locks. the return is made by coach"




"FREMONT - Sometimes referred to as "The People's Republic of Fremont," and at one time a center of the counterculture, Fremont was renowned as Seattle’s most artistically eccentric community. It is the home to a statue of Lenin salvaged from Slovakia by a local art lover, to the Fremont Troll, an 18-foot tall concrete sculpture of a troll crushing a Volkswagen Beetle in its right hand, as well as to signs proclaiming conflicting messages such as «Set your watch ahead five minutes», «Set your watch back five minutes» and «Throw your watch away»! Since the late 90s, residents refer to Fremont as «The Center of the Universe!»"


"SPACE NEEDLE TOWER - Built for the 1962 World's Fair, the tower is the Pacific Northwest's most recognizable landmark and a the symbol of Seattle"


"MOUNT RAINIER - «Look, the mountain is out!» Mount Rainier is a stratovolcano located 87 km southeast of Seattle, and is the highest peak in the Cascade Range - 4,392 m. The mountain is mostly covered by snow, but heat from the volcano keeps parts of its summit free of ice"
